Guide to Smart Homes: Explore the Future of Connected Living

Smart homes are residential environments equipped with interconnected devices, sensors, and systems that automate, monitor and control different aspects of living space—such as lighting, climate, security, entertainment and energy management.

The evolution of smart homes is a part of the broader trend of connected living: homes that respond, adapt and anticipate based on occupants’ habits and needs. With the rise of internet-of-things (IoT), high-speed connectivity, and home automation platforms, what once seemed futuristic is now increasingly mainstream.

Importance

Connected living through smart homes matters for several reasons:

  • Convenience & adaptability: Smart homes simplify daily routines via automation (for example lighting, climate, security) and remote access.

  • Energy & resource efficiency: By using smart sensors and device integration, homes can optimise energy usage, minimise waste and reduce utility bills.

  • Well-being & safety: Monitoring systems for air quality, occupancy, water/soil sensors and security tools contribute to healthier and safer living environments.

  • Personalisation & experience: Homes become responsive to individual routines, preferences and lifestyles, offering tailored ambience, entertainment and comfort.

  • Scalable future infrastructure: As more homes adopt smart systems, connected living zones can integrate into broader smart city and smart grid frameworks.

Laws or Policies

Connected homes are shaped by regulatory and policy frameworks that address safety, data rights, energy usage and device interoperability:

  • Energy & emission standards: Smart home systems that manage heating, cooling, lighting and water use contribute to national energy efficiency targets.

  • Data privacy & cybersecurity regulations: As homes become more connected, legislation around data protection, IoT device security and consumer consent become critical.

  • Building/installation codes: Smart home installations must comply with wiring, fire safety, sensor placement, and building structural regulations.

  • Interoperability/industry standards: Protocols and standards ensure devices from different manufacturers can work together reliably, supporting consumer choice and long-term viability.

FAQs

1. What counts as a smart home?
A smart home is one that uses connected devices and systems to monitor, automate or control key home functions (lighting, climate, security, appliances) with minimal manual effort.

2. Are smart homes only for luxury houses?
No. While early adoption was luxury-oriented, many smart home devices and systems are now available across budgets. The focus increasingly is on functionality, efficiency and convenience rather than luxury alone.

3. Is connected living safe from a data/privacy perspective?
There are risks, but with proper device choice, strong network security (passwords, segmentation, updates) and adherence to IoT security best practices, connected homes can be safe. It’s important to choose devices with clear data policies and robust security features.

4. How does a smart home save energy?
Smart homes use sensors and automation to reduce waste (e.g., lights off when rooms unoccupied, optimized HVAC cycles, smart shading). They also provide data so homeowners can make better decisions.

5. What’s next for smart homes?
Future homes will become more adaptive and intuitive—anticipating needs, learning behavior, integrating health/wellness features, and working seamlessly across devices and brands. Automation will be less visible and more built-in
